Pengeluaran

Output terraform bergantung_on

Output terraform bergantung_on
  1. Bagaimana anda lulus nilai output di Terraform?
  2. Apa itu Terraform bergantung_on?
  3. Bagaimana anda menentukan bergantung pada terraform?
  4. Bolehkah saya menggunakan pemboleh ubah output di terraform?
  5. Bagaimana anda menentukan output di Terraform?
  6. Apa itu $ di Terraform?
  7. Apakah pembolehubah input dan output di terraform?
  8. Bolehkah kita mempunyai 2 penyedia di terraform?
  9. Bagaimana anda mengisytiharkan pemboleh ubah dalam terraform?
  10. Bagaimana anda lulus pemboleh ubah dalam modul terraform?
  11. Bagaimana saya mendapatkan output terraform modul?
  12. Bagaimana anda memberikan nilai kepada pemboleh ubah dalam terraform?
  13. Bagaimana anda lulus nilai?
  14. Bagaimana anda lulus pembolehubah dalam param?
  15. Bagaimana anda merujuk pemboleh ubah dalam terraform?

Bagaimana anda lulus nilai output di Terraform?

Mengisytiharkan dan menggunakan nilai output. Dalam contoh di atas, kami menentukan nilai output dengan nama instance_public_ip. Dengan cara ini, kita boleh lulus nilai ke modul induk atau memaparkannya ke pengguna akhir jika ia adalah output modul akar.

Apa itu Terraform bergantung_on?

bergantung_on membolehkan anda membuat pergantungan yang jelas antara dua sumber. Kebergantungan tidak terhad kepada sumber sahaja. Mereka boleh dibuat antara modul. Apabila ketergantungan adalah modul, bergantung_on mempengaruhi urutan di mana terraform memproses semua sumber dan sumber data yang berkaitan dengan modul tersebut.

Bagaimana anda menentukan bergantung pada terraform?

Anda boleh menggunakan bergantung kepada_on untuk menyatakan secara jelas kebergantungan. Anda juga boleh menentukan pelbagai sumber dalam hujah bergantung, dan terraform akan menunggu sehingga semuanya telah dibuat sebelum mencipta sumber sasaran.

Bolehkah saya menggunakan pemboleh ubah output di terraform?

Pembolehubah output terraform digunakan dalam modul ibu bapa atau anak yang sama untuk mencetak nilai tertentu dalam output baris arahan dan juga digunakan sebagai input untuk membuat sumber menggunakan perintah terraform memohon. Di bawah, anda dapat melihat arahan memaparkan contoh EC2 Output ARN dan contoh alamat IP awam.

Bagaimana anda menentukan output di Terraform?

Mengisytiharkan nilai output

Label sebaik sahaja kata kunci output adalah nama, yang mesti menjadi pengenal yang sah. Dalam modul akar, nama ini dipaparkan kepada pengguna; Dalam modul kanak -kanak, ia boleh digunakan untuk mengakses nilai output. Hujah nilai mengambil ungkapan yang hasilnya dikembalikan kepada pengguna.

Apa itu $ di Terraform?

Tertanam dalam rentetan di terraform, sama ada anda menggunakan sintaks terraform atau sintaks JSON, anda boleh menginterpolasi nilai lain. Interpolasi ini dibungkus dengan $ , seperti $ var. foo . Sintaks interpolasi berkuasa dan membolehkan anda untuk merujuk pembolehubah, atribut sumber, fungsi panggilan, dll.

Apakah pembolehubah input dan output di terraform?

Pembolehubah input berfungsi sebagai parameter untuk modul terraform, jadi pengguna dapat menyesuaikan tingkah laku tanpa mengedit sumber. Nilai output adalah seperti nilai pulangan untuk modul terraform. Nilai Tempatan adalah ciri kemudahan untuk memberikan nama pendek kepada ungkapan.

Bolehkah kita mempunyai 2 penyedia di terraform?

Terraform boleh berurusan dengan pelbagai penyedia dan pada dasarnya menjadi Orchestrator.

Bagaimana anda mengisytiharkan pemboleh ubah dalam terraform?

Tetapkan nama contoh dengan pemboleh ubah

Tambahkan pemboleh ubah untuk menentukan nama contoh. Buat fail baru yang disebut pembolehubah.TF dengan blok yang menentukan pemboleh ubah contoh_name baru. Nota: Terraform memuat semua fail dalam direktori semasa yang berakhir .TF, jadi anda boleh menamakan fail konfigurasi anda tetapi anda memilih.

Bagaimana anda lulus pemboleh ubah dalam modul terraform?

Cara pertama anda boleh lulus pembolehubah di dalam modul anak anda adalah untuk menentukan pembolehubah.fail TF pada modul utama anda dan terraform. tfvars. Maka anda juga harus menentukan pembolehubah.fail TF di dalam setiap modul dan mengandungi definisi setiap modul.

Bagaimana saya mendapatkan output terraform modul?

Output dari modul kanak -kanak tidak dipaparkan sebagai output dalam modul utama. Anda perlu membuat output secara eksplisit dalam modul utama jika anda ingin mengeluarkan output modul kanak -kanak. Jalankan Terraform Init, Rancang, dan Sapukan Perintah Lagi. Modul akar mengeluarkan hasil modul kanak -kanak.

Bagaimana anda memberikan nilai kepada pemboleh ubah dalam terraform?

Cara paling mudah untuk memberikan nilai kepada pemboleh ubah menggunakan pilihan -var dalam baris arahan ketika menjalankan pelan terraform dan terraform memohon arahan.

Bagaimana anda lulus nilai?

Di C#, hujah boleh diserahkan kepada parameter sama ada dengan nilai atau dengan rujukan. Ingat bahawa jenis C# boleh sama ada jenis rujukan (kelas) atau jenis nilai (struct): lulus nilai dengan cara meluluskan salinan pembolehubah kepada kaedah. Lulus dengan rujukan bermaksud lulus akses kepada pemboleh ubah ke kaedah.

Bagaimana anda lulus pembolehubah dalam param?

Tambah nilai parameter

Untuk lulus nilai parameter, tambahnya ke rentetan pertanyaan pada akhir URL asas. Dalam contoh di atas, nama skrip parameter paparan adalah viewParameter1.

Bagaimana anda merujuk pemboleh ubah dalam terraform?

Pembolehubah Terraform boleh ditakrifkan dalam pelan infrastruktur tetapi disyorkan untuk disimpan dalam fail pembolehubah mereka sendiri. Semua fail dalam direktori Terraform anda menggunakan . Format fail TF akan dimuat secara automatik semasa operasi. Buat fail pembolehubah, contohnya, pembolehubah.TF dan buka fail untuk diedit.

Bagaimana saya sepenuhnya memadam tapak/akaun GCP/semuanya
Bagaimana saya memadam semua perkhidmatan di GCP?Adakah Google memadam data secara kekal?Bagaimana saya memadamkan akaun saya secara kekal?Bagaimana ...
Melaksanakan syarat yang tepat untuk perintah yum untuk centos5 di ansible
Apa gunanya modul yum di ansible?Bagaimana anda lulus arahan dalam buku main ansible?Modul mana yang digunakan untuk keadaan di ansible?Apa yang ada ...
Projek Pangkalan Data Depploy ke AWS RDS Endpoint
DB mana yang boleh digunakan dalam AWS RDS?Apakah kaedah paling mudah untuk memindahkan pangkalan data?Bagaimana saya memulihkan pangkalan data sql p...